* source/compiler/harbour.c
* source/compiler/harbour.y
+ Added support for DECLARE FunName(...) AS CLASS ClassName
+ Added support for DECLARE FunName( ... @SomeFun() ... ) - Function Pointer declared parameter.
* source/compiler/simplex.c
* Corrected some compiler warnings.
* source/compiler/harbour.slx
* Reenabled support for ID_ON_HOLD.
* include/hberror.h
+ Added: #define HB_COMP_WARN_RETURN_SUSPECT 28
* source/compiler/hbgenerr.c
+ Added: "4Suspecious return type: \'%s\' expected: \'%s\'"
* source/compiler/hbpcode.c
+ Completed support for Strong Typed variables as declared classes, as well as Adaptive Typed usage with declared classes.
* Few other corrections and enhancements.
* include/hbclass.ch
+ Added TClass declaration:
DECLARE TClass ;
New( cName AS STRING, OPTIONAL SuperParams ) AS CLASS TClass ;
Create() AS OBJECT;
Instance() AS OBJECT ;
AddClsMthds( cName AS STRING, @Method(), nScope AS NUMERIC, n2 AS NUMERIC, n3 AS NUMERIC );
AddMultiClsData( cType AS STRING, uVal, nScope AS NUMERIC, aDatas AS ARRAY OF STRING );
AddMultiData( cType AS STRING, uVal, nScope AS NUMERIC, aDatas AS ARRAY OF STRING );
AddMethod( cName AS STRING, @Method(), nScope AS NUMERIC );
AddInLine( cName AS STRING, bBlock AS CODEBLOCK, nScope AS NUMERIC );
AddVirtual( cName AS STRING )
+ Added declaration to s_oClass AS CLASS TClass
* tests/testdecl.prg
* Minor refinement.
